Default 78 30 scarab, what to look for

Brother in law looking at boat, wondering what to look for, typical problems in these. Hull sides seem really bouncy when you thump them, transom seems hard. These are known for rot correct? He doesn't want a project, just liked looks and price. I know a few of you guys have done these.

tranom and stringer rot are the number one killer of wellcrafts. a 78 anything will probably need some tlc...
